I see what I think is a great new business opportunity, what do I do next?

Anybody with a mind for business should always keep an eye out for their next business opportunity. If you are a business owner, you already know this.

When you see a new business opportunity, you may find it difficult to determine your next step- especially if this opportunity is outside of your usual field.

However, whether you are expanding your business in your current field or venturing out into new territories, seizing a great new opportunity is one of the most vital parts of running a business.

Thankfully, pursuing a new business opportunity is not as difficult or scary as it sounds.

If you do your research and proceed in a calculated manner, your business can thrive off this new opportunity. Let’s look at some of the best ways to capitalize on a unique opportunity.

Consult Your Associates And Analysts

No matter how good a business opportunity may seem, it is not wise to jump in without information. You will always want to receive opinions on these matters.

For small businesses, you may want to engage in conversation with some of your trusted associates, whether it be your business partners, a fellow business owner, or a family member.

These people will have opinions based on their personal experiences and can help you form a better plan on how to proceed.

On the other hand, larger businesses may have a consultant on staff, such as a financial analyst. These employees are great resources to generate profit estimates for your new business opportunity.

Research The Market

You may have stumbled upon the most unique business opportunity in the world, but that means nothing if people do not respond to it.

Put in some time researching the market related to your new opportunity. You must determine what the nearest competitors in this niche are and how successful they are.

If they are successful, why? What are they doing to put them over their competitors, and how can you improve upon it?

Market research is one of the most vital parts of running any business and expanding into a new business opportunity is no exception!

Collaborate And Be Flexible

Rome wasn’t built in a day, but it also was not built by one person. If you want to capitalize on a great new business opportunity, you must open yourself up to collaboration.

While consulting your associates can give you great ideas for your initial stages, you should not stop listening to them once the ball starts rolling.

Additionally, your employees can be an exceptional resource for ideas. In a similar vein, keep an eye out for emerging talents in the field of your new business opportunity. Manpower can make your project outperform expectations!

Act Quickly

This step may seem somewhat contradictory- if you have to do market research and consult your associates, how can you also act quickly?

Unfortunately, you simply cannot afford to do otherwise. If a business opportunity is as great as you expect, somebody will attach themselves to it- you just have to ensure that person is you!
